The 2N3563 pinout describes a high-frequency NPN silicon transistor specially designed for RF and IF amplifier or oscillator circuits. It offers low noise, stable gain, and high reliability, making it ideal for radio frequency receivers, signal boosters, and oscillator stages in VHF communication systems. The 2N4123 pinout follows the Emitter–Base–Collector (E–B–C) sequence and it is a general-purpose NPN transistor widely used in low-power signal processing, amplifier, and switching applications. Known for its fast response, high transition frequency, and low noise characteristics, the 2N4123 is a versatile choice for RF circuits, analog signal amplification, and digital switching.
